[Bug fortran/24261] gfortran ALLOCATE statement does not align objects on 16-byte boundary



------- Comment #1 from pinskia at gcc dot gnu dot org  2005-10-07 17:05 -------
Fixed by:
2005-10-01  Jakub Jelinek  <jakub@redhat.com>

        * runtime/memory.c (malloc_t): Remove.
        (GFC_MALLOC_MAGIC, HEADER_SIZE, DATA_POINTER, DATA_HEADER): Remove.
        (mem_root, runtime_cleanup, malloc_with_header): Remove.
        (internal_malloc_size): Use just get_mem if size != 0, return NULL
        otherwise.
        (internal_free): Just free if non-NULL.
        (internal_realloc_size): Remove debugging stuff.
        (allocate_size): Use malloc directly, remove debugging stuff.
        (deallocate): Use free directly, fix error message wording.


If it is not then it is a bug in glibc, complain to them.
